Once you make an application for an educatonal loan, the financial institution identifies how much money youre permitted discovered during the a particular college or university centered on your school’s price of attendance, referred to as new COA, and any other financial aid you’ve got received. The brand new COA are a proper number dependent on for every school, dependent on one institution’s costs. It typically is sold with:

  • tuition & charges
  • homes (into or of-campus) & resources
  • diet plans or food
  • courses & provides
  • transportation (vehicle parking, public transportation, etcetera.)
  • private expenditures

What things to learn: Very universities will receive an appartment budget for off-university casing so that they ount of book or ingredients in the event that you are living out of campus. It is best to speak along with your school’s school funding work environment to allow her or him know if you intend to live of campus so they can become when you can in your COA to fund men and women expenses. VSAC, Vermont’s nonprofit degree agencies, is provide to own regarding-campus houses, delicacies and you will relevant expenditures as long as their college or university is actually able to help you approve it is part of your COA.

Student loans are usually disbursed to the college to pay for tuition and you can charges, as well as place and board if you are life style toward campus. Any money left over is reimbursed towards the college student or debtor.

Once you get the education loan reimburse, you might deposit that cash to your checking account to utilize to cover cost of living.

What to know: If you will you would like currency getting away from-university homes for the August (including the protection deposit and you may initial book), bundle ahead for how might security men and women very first will set you back ahead of your loan funds appear. Generally, the school says to the lending company when you should upload the bucks when you look at the the borrowed funds disbursement. Of numerous universities request the amount of money to your slip name installment loan San Antonio into the August otherwise Sep, as well as the money to the springtime identity for the January. The procedure takes some time to help you reimburse any empty piece of the loans to the pupil. Contact your college or university to test the timing of one’s reimburse.

  • Budget for and you will monitor your own expenses. The loan finance should last you up until the 2nd semester otherwise informative seasons (depending on how your loan cash is paid). Budget wisely so that you never work on brief. The rent and you will ingredients need make for the cover off-campus housing that university lets.
  • Avoid way too many paying. Increase student loan bucks by reducing expenses and economizing during university. Avoid using your student education loans to have spring split traveling, clothes, dining, expensive electronic devices, or other so many expenses. Follow the cardinal rule: Alive like a student at school and that means you don’t have to live for example one to for 10 years immediately after graduation.
  • Have fun with any excessive financing to begin with trying to repay your loan. If you are paying the eye on your own loan while you are for the college or university, you might eliminate what you should have to pay back shortly after graduation.

Students make an application for federal college loans by completing the brand new FAFSA. Brand new 100 % free App to own Government Pupil Assistance determines exactly what federal pupil fund and you can federal educational funding you are qualified to receive. Because the government student education loans have special pros and you may protections, college students should always make an application for that money firstpare your own other available choices before you apply to own government Along with funds.

Individual college loans are supplied by the banking companies, credit unions, nonprofit condition enterprises to possess degree (such as for example VSAC), and online loan providers. Approval will be based upon creditworthiness. Most of the private loan providers keeps various other rates and you may words, making it crucial that you examine. Recognize how the rate and the fees bundle you select tend to impact your own total price regarding borrowing from the bank.
